Summary of Steel Roofing
Metal roof covering has gained appeal in recent times due to its durability and aesthetic allure. When you select steel roof covering, you're choosing a material that can hold up against severe weather, including hefty rainfall, snow, and high winds.
Unlike standard shingles, steel roofs can last 40 to 70 years with minimal upkeep, making them a lasting financial investment.
An additional advantage of metal roof is its power performance. You'll find that several metal roofings are developed to mirror solar warm, which can help reduce your air conditioning costs during hot summer months.
And also, steel roofings are usually made from recycled products, which interest eco aware home owners.

Summary of Shingle Roof
When taking into consideration roofing options, shingle roofing continues to be a popular choice among property owners for its price and flexibility. Shingles come in different materials, including asphalt, wood, and fiberglass, permitting you to choose a style that fits your home's visual and spending plan. Asphalt roof shingles are one of the most common type, known for their cost-effectiveness and convenience of installation.
Among the primary benefits of shingle roof covering is its wide variety of design and colors. This versatility suggests you can easily match your roofing to your home's outside. Furthermore, shingle roofing systems generally have a life expectancy of 20 to three decades, relying on the material and upkeep, making them a functional long-term financial investment.
Setup is normally quick and uncomplicated, which can conserve you on labor expenses. You can typically discover local specialists who specialize in tile roof covering, offering you choices for competitive pricing.
While shingle roofings may not have the same longevity as metal roofing systems, their reduced preliminary price and convenience of repair service make them an appealing option for many house owners. Generally, roof shingles roof supplies an equilibrium of cost, aesthetic appeal, and usefulness that continues to reverberate with those wanting to boost their homes.
Key Contrasts and Considerations
Choosing between metal and tile roof covering entails a number of key contrasts and factors to consider that can considerably impact your decision.
Initially, think about toughness. Steel roof coverings can last 40 to 70 years, while asphalt roof shingles generally last 15 to thirty years. This longevity indicates that although metal may have a greater in advance expense, it can conserve you money over time.
Next off, think about upkeep. Metal roofings need less maintenance, resisting mold and mildew and mildew, while tiles may require more frequent inspections and repairs.
